New York home sales slip nearly 5 percent in September

The drop ends a streak of 12 straight monthly gains ALBANY — New York realtors sold 13,274 previously owned homes in September, down 4.6 percent from 13,907 homes sold in September 2020. Upstate, statewide consumer sentiment plummet in Q3

Upstate New Yorkers became less confident about economic conditions in the third quarter of 2021. Consumer sentiment in Upstate was measured at 63.4 in the third quarter, down 13.2 points from the last reading of 76.6 in this year’s second quarter.
